In today's digital age, accounting software has become an indispensable tool for businesses of all sizes. It streamlines financial processes, will increase efficiency, and provides valuable insights into an organization's financial health. Nevertheless, the convenience of accounting software additionally brings with it a significant concern - the security of your monetary data. Protecting your monetary data needs to be a top priority, and this article delves into the significance of accounting software security and gives essential tips to safeguard your sensitive monetary information.
The Importance of Accounting Software Security
Monetary Data is Gold: Your monetary data is akin to gold within the eyes of cybercriminals. It contains sensitive information like bank account details, employee payroll, tax information, and much more. If this data falls into the wrong hands, it can lead to monetary losses, legal troubles, and damage to your reputation.
Regulatory Compliance: Numerous laws and laws require businesses to protect their financial data. Non-compliance can result in hefty fines and legal consequences. Accounting software security ensures that you simply adright here to these regulations.
Trust and Reputation: Customers and clients trust businesses that handle their financial information securely. A breach in security can erode trust and damage your organization's fame irreparably.
Key Tips for Protecting Your Financial Data
Select a Reputable Accounting Software: Start by deciding on accounting software from a reputable vendor. Look for software that has a track record of prioritizing security and repeatedly updates its security features.
Password Management: Be sure that your employees use strong, unique passwords for their accounts. Implement two-factor authentication wherever possible. Often update and alter passwords to reduce the risk of unauthorized access.
Encryption: Data encryption is crucial in safeguarding your monetary data. Ensure that your accounting software makes use of encryption protocols to protect data each in transit and at rest.
Common Updates: Keep your accounting software as much as date. Vendors usually launch security patches and updates to address vulnerabilities. Failing to update your software may depart you uncovered to known security threats.
Access Controls: Implement strict access controls. Only authorized personnel should have access to sensitive monetary data. Prohibit permissions to make sure that employees can only access the information vital for their roles.
Employee Training: Educate your employees concerning the significance of security. Train them to recognize phishing makes an attempt and to observe best practices when handling financial data.
Common Backups: Commonly back up your monetary data and store backups securely. In case of a data breach or system failure, having backups can prevent data loss.
Firepartitions and Antivirus Software: Install firewalls and reliable antivirus software to protect your systems from malware and different threats. Keep these security tools updated.
Incident Response Plan: Develop a complete incident response plan that outlines what steps to take in case of a security breach. This plan ought to include notifying relevant authorities and affected parties promptly.
Third-Party Risk Assessment: If you happen to use third-party providers that have access to your monetary data, assess their security measures. Ensure they meet your security standards and commonly evaluate their practices.
Common Audits: Conduct common security audits and assessments to establish vulnerabilities and weaknesses in your accounting software and processes. This proactive approach will help you address potential points before they develop into major security threats.
Data Encryption during Transmission: Be certain that your accounting software encrypts data when it's transmitted over the internet. This protects your data from interception during transmission.
Limit Access on Mobile Devices: In case your accounting software offers mobile access, limit the data that can be accessed from mobile devices. Mobile gadgets are more inclined to loss or theft, making it essential to attenuate the data exposure.
